Types of Dental Services in Wolverhampton
- General Dentistry: Routine examinations, cleanings, fillings, and preventive care
- Cosmetic Dentistry: Teeth whitening, veneers, and smile makeovers
- Orthodontics: Braces, Invisalign, and teeth straightening
- Oral Surgery: Extractions, implants, and wisdom teeth removal
- Periodontics: Gum disease treatment and maintenance
- Paediatric Dentistry: Specialist dental care for children

NHS vs Private Dental Care
In Wolverhampton, you can choose between NHS and private dental care. NHS dentistry offers subsidised treatment at fixed prices, while private practices may offer additional services, flexible appointments, and shorter waiting times. Many practices in Wolverhampton offer both NHS and private options.
